String类方法
String str=new String(); //String类的无参构造方法
String str=new String("abcd"); //可以赋初值的构造方法
str.length() //求str的长度
str.indexOf('e',10) //从第10个元素开始向后寻找e
str.euqals(str0) //判断str是否和str0相等
str.charAt(10) //取出str中第十个字符
str.substring(5,25) //截取str第5到第25个字符
str.touppercase() //将所有字符转换为大写
str.tolowercase() //将所有字符转换为小写
str.replace('a','b') //把所有的a换为b
源代码:
import java.util.*;
public class Ove{ public static void main(String args[]){ String B=new String("abcdefghijklmnopqrstwvuxyz"); String A=new String("abcdefghijklmnopqrstwvuxyz"); System.out.println(A.length()); System.out.println(A.equals(B)); System.out.println(A.toUpperCase()); System.out.println(A.toUpperCase().toLowerCase()); System.out.println(A.toCharArray()); System.out.println(A.trim()); System.out.println(A.indexOf("e",5)); System.out.println(A.substring(5,25)); System.out.println(A.startsWith("sdf")); System.out.println(A.endsWith("asdadwadawdas")); System.out.println(A.replace('a','b')); System.out.println(A.charAt(10));}
}
截图